On Wed, Apr 6, 2016 at 5:23 PM, Mallela, Anil <anil.mallela@emc.com> wrote:

Hi,

           PostgreSQL master/slave Streaming replication is working fine .I also changed slave as master using trigger file.

I need some clarification on the below 2 scenarios:

1. once slave become master whatever the tables are created in new master it’s not replicated to old master, how to replicate the same from new master to old master


The tables created in the new database won't be replicated to the old master unless you set up replication from the new master to the old master.
 

2. How to make old master as slave (which should accept  read only transactions)

 

Can you please help me regarding this and  also tell me is the above approach is valid or not.

I have tried  3 nodes(master/slave)—master(bring down master)/make it slave as master/and created new slave  and it is working fine.

There is nothing wrong in using the old master as a slave and the new one as master from now on, if the machine on which new master is as good as the one on which the old master was running (memory,processor, disk speed etc). The process to be followed is the same as what you followed when you set up the earlier master-slave environment. It sounds as though you have the new set up working fine.
If you want to automate the process, you could take a look at a tool like pgpool-II. It does add some overhead and you have to learn a new tool. Look under the section  Pgpool Failback here
